“Upset” Woman Allegedly Throws Boiling Water on Toddler and Teen
Share and Follow

A Texas woman has been taken into custody after allegedly causing severe injuries by dousing two young children with boiling water. The victims, a toddler and a teenager, suffered serious burns.

Stacy Gilbert was apprehended in the early morning of January 20, following a call to a residence in San Antonio. Upon arrival, police discovered a 2-year-old and a 13-year-old with significant burn injuries, according to an initial report from the San Antonio Police Department.

Authorities revealed that Gilbert, for reasons yet to be determined, became agitated with the children and assaulted them by throwing boiling water while they were in their bedroom.

The injured children were promptly taken to a hospital for treatment. Gilbert faces charges that include Injury to a Child with Intent to Cause Bodily Harm and Injury to a Child through Reckless Conduct.

A representative from the San Antonio Police Department informed Oxygen that Gilbert and the victims are related, though the exact nature of their familial connection has not been disclosed.

Neighbors in Gilbert’s community who spoke to San Antonio news station KSAT, expressed their concern. 

“Honestly, I can’t really imagine why anyone would do that,” one resident told the station. “They’re kids.” 

Added another neighbor, “That is treacherous to do something like that . 

Oxygen could not locate an attorney for Gilbert.
